makro formülde hata

aligunes

Altın Üye
Katılım
2 Mart 2005
Mesajlar
304
Excel Vers. ve Dili
Ofis 2016 TR 32 Bit
Altın Üyelik Bitiş Tarihi
09-06-2025
Sub aktar1()
a = WorksheetFunction.CountA(Sheets("TAHAKKUK TESLİM").Range("F5:F65536"))
Sheets("TAHAKKUK TESLİM").Range("A" & a + 5) = a + 1
Sheets("TAHAKKUK TESLİM").Range("H" & a + 5) = [s6]
Sheets("TAHAKKUK TESLİM").Range("I" & a + 5) = [o14]
Sheets("TAHAKKUK TESLİM").Range("F" & a + 5) = [r41]
Sheets("TAHAKKUK TESLİM").Range("E" & a + 5) = [m37] + [m38] + [m39] + [m40]
Sheets("TAHAKKUK TESLİM").Range("G" & a + 5) = [f14] & "." & [g14] & "." & [h14] & "." & [ı14] & "-" & [j14] & "-" & [k14] & "." & [l14] & "." & [m14] & "." & [n14]

a = WorksheetFunction.CountA(Sheets("İCMAL").Range("F3:F65536"))
Sheets("İCMAL").Range("A" & a + 3) = a + 1
Sheets("İCMAL").Range("B" & a + 3) = [u6]
Sheets("İCMAL").Range("C" & a + 3) = [r42]
Sheets("İCMAL").Range("D" & a + 3) = [u1]
Sheets("İCMAL").Range("E" & a + 3) = [r41]
Sheets("İCMAL").Range("G" & a + 3) = [r42]
Sheets("İCMAL").Range("H" & a + 3) = [m38]

End Sub

fomül bu : Aktar butonuna tıkladığımda "Tahakkuk Teslim" ve "İcmal" Listesine Aktarma yapıyor ,Fakat Tahakkuk Teslimde aktarılan bilgileri sildiğim de yine 3.satırdan başlarken İcmalde bunu yapmıyor İcmalde en son aktardığı satıra yazmaya devam ediyor önceki satırları silsemde yine devam ediyor yardımlarınız için şimdiden tüm form üyelerine teşekkürler.
 
Katılım
29 Eylül 2004
Mesajlar
1,810
Excel Vers. ve Dili
Excel 2002 TR
İkiside kopyalamayı yaptığına göre Kodlarda bir hata yok, mantıkta hata var muhtemelen. Her iki sayfa içinde a(yazdırılacak satır) F sütununa bakarak belirlemişsiniz, muhtemelen TT sayfasında F sütununu silerken İcmal Sayfasında silmiyorsunuz (çünki kodlarda F sütununa birşey yazdırmamışsınız). bunun için alttaki
a 'nın tespiti için başka bir sütun deneyin. mesela

a = WorksheetFunction.CountA(Sheets("İCMAL").Range("A3:A65536"))
 
Üst